Integer Operations Flowchart

Integer Operation Rules Flowchart



Integer operations are HUGE in math because once you learn them, they DON'T go AWAY!  In fact, I have known many an 8th grader to get these rules confused and make mistakes that mess up the rest of their work.  So, getting these correct is very important for middle school students.

This flowchart will help organize the rules in a concise manner.  It's dangerous to teach students to only change a subtraction sign, because in high school that doesn't always work the same way (think distributive property!)

You can use this as a quick reference for students who need to practice perfectly. 

Integer Operations Game

Integer Operations GAME!

XP Math Games Search

This is another wonderful resource that is FREE!
Any student in grades 6-8 can find a topic to practice while playing a game.  The integer game works multiplication and division facts with the integers thrown in to the mix.  As a teacher, I LOVE the way the game forces the student to think and there is IMMEDIATE feedback.  They have a few options to choose from, but only one is correct. 

The wonderful thing is that there are MANY more to choose from.  I will post the XP Math link on the pre-algebra site as well for future reference.  This would make a great station, enrichment activity or homework help.  Kids love online games- lets give them a brain work out in the process!
